For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 339 students in Sparta Community Unit School District 140. This district's average high testing ranking is 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public high schools in Illinois.
Public High School in Sparta Community Unit School District 140 have an average math proficiency score of 17% (versus the Illinois public high school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 22% (versus the 29% statewide average).
Public High School in Sparta Community Unit School District 140 have a Graduation Rate of 77%, which is less than the Illinois average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Sparta High School, with 75-79%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Illinois or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 24%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Illinois public high school average of 55% (majority Hispanic).

The revenue/student of $17,981 in this school district is less than the state median of $22,430.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$16,260 is less than the state median of $21,668. The school district spending/student has grown by 10% over four school years.
